Show Notes

TWiV reviews experiments to understand infection, pathogenesis, and transmission of avian H5N1 influenza virus in goats, and identification of a cellular receptor for tick-borne encephalitis virus.

Hosts: Vincent Racaniello, Alan Dove, and Brianne Barker
